Coorporoo, QLD - Presbyterian
Year Built: 1951
Address: 37 Emlyn Street, , Coorparoo Queensland, 4151
Presbyterian services in Coorparoo were held from 1926 in the Shire Hall under the care of the Kirk Session of St John's, Annerley, but within a few years a church was built and in 1931 Coorparoo became a separate charge.1 The present brick church was opened on 11 November 1951.

Dalby, QLD - St John's Anglican
Year Built: 1922
Address: 153 Cunningham Street, , Dalby Queensland, 4405
The Foundation stone was laid by the Right Honourable H.W.B. Forster of Lepe on 29 August 1922. St John's Church, Dalby is a brick church constructed in 1922-1923 to the design of Harry Marks and is the third church of this name on the site. Eagle Junction, QLD - Uniting (Former)
Year Built: 1889
Address: 223 Bonney Avenue, , Clayfield Queensland, 4011
The Church was built in circa 1889 and in 1901, not wishing to be part of the amalgamation of the Methodist denominations into the new Methodist Church of Australasia, the congregation decided to became Eagle Junction Congregational Church. Eight Mile Plains, QLD - St Paul's Anglican (Former)
Year Built: 1902
Address: 17 Millers Road, , Eight Mile Plains Queensland, 4113
The church was built between 1902 and 1904 as a combined effort by volunteers drawn from the Church of England, Catholic, Methodist and Lutheran members of the local community. Fortitude Valley, QLD - Presbyterian (Former)
Year Built: 1885
Address: 28 Warner Street, , Fortitude Valley Queensland, 4006
The Fortitude Valley Presbyterian Church was started ia a very modest way on 14th February, 1866, when a congregation was formed in the Valley and met in a small cottage in Ann Street, near Morgan Street. Freestone, QLD - St Luke's Anglican
Year Built: 1883
Address: Upper Freestone Road, , Freestone Queensland, 4370
On June 5th 1883, the Society for Promoting Christian Knowledge based in London, made a grant of £20 towards the cost of constructing a wooden Church at Freestone Creek, the total cost of this Church was £175.
